How does the Dell PowerEdge XE9680 enhance AI and HPC performance?
The Dell PowerEdge XE9680 drives AI and HPC acceleration by combining dual 5th Gen Intel Xeon Scalable CPUs with up to eight NVIDIA H100 or H200 Tensor Core GPUs. This architecture delivers outstanding compute density, massive memory bandwidth, and fast interconnect speeds through NVLink and NVSwitch, enabling efficient training of large AI models and scientific simulations.
The system also supports PCIe Gen5 for high-speed data movement between storage, GPUs, and networking components. Its optimized airflow design ensures stable performance during long compute cycles common in deep learning workloads.
| Core Components | Specification Highlights |
|---|---|
| Processor | Up to two 5th Gen Intel Xeon Scalable CPUs |
| GPU Support | Up to eight NVIDIA H100 or H200 GPUs |
| Memory | 32 DIMM slots, DDR5 up to 4800 MT/s |
| Storage | NVMe, SAS/SATA, optional BOSS-N1 for boot |
| Networking | Up to 400 Gbps with ConnectX-7 or Broadcom |
What makes the PowerEdge XE9680 ideal for large-scale AI environments?
The XE9680’s eight-GPU SXM5 architecture provides high computational throughput and low latency for AI clusters. NVLink and NVSwitch create a unified GPU memory space, enabling efficient scaling for LLM training, multi-modal AI, and reinforcement learning. Dell’s OpenManage toolkit simplifies autonomous monitoring and workload optimization.

How does the XE9680 support enterprise-level security and compliance?
Dell integrates hardware-rooted security using silicon-based trust anchors, automatic BIOS recovery, signed firmware, TPM 2.0, and secure boot. These features protect against firmware tampering and maintain system integrity across distributed compute environments.
